# --- Per-tenant rate quotas ---
# Quotas below are defaults only. Actual limits are resolved per tenant
# at request time from the quota service. Do NOT hand-edit values here
# to unblock a customer; overrides set in this file are wiped on deploy.
# For support escalations, raise a quota override through the Tollgate
# admin tool instead. Current effective quotas per tenant can be
# inspected in the quota database, reachable via the connection string below.

primary connection of yagep-kahip = redis://giliel_svc:zYiKsLL2PLpfPL@db-348f.xolmarsys.corp:5432/fenwyn

## v2.4.1 — Key rotation

Hey newcomers! Quick note: we rotated the signing key for FeedCheckly, our podcast feed validator, after the old one hit its 90-day limit. Nothing broke, but cached validation badges may look stale for an hour. If you're setting up a local build, grab the new key below and drop it into your config. Here's the current signing key:

release key, fajef-kajeg: bky19_LdLu6Ne6FLi8he2c24d

Dependency pinning policy, short version: every build at Quellmark pins exact versions. No ranges, no wildcards, no floating tags. Lockfiles are committed and verified in CI; unpinned transitive dependencies fail the gate. Upgrades go through the Ferrule review queue, one dependency per change, with diff of the resolved tree attached. Emergency bumps require sign-off from the platform lead and a follow-up audit within five days. The full policy, exceptions list, and audit checklist live on the internal page below.

wiki page, tahaf-tajog: https://jira.ordindyn.corp/pipeline

Handover note — Crumbwheel order cutoffs.

Welcome aboard. The bakery cutoff rule in Crumbwheel closes same-day orders at 14:00 local to each storefront, not UTC — this has bitten us twice. Holiday overrides live in the calendar service and take precedence silently, so always check there first when a cutoff looks wrong. To unlock the calendar service's admin console after a restart, enter the recovery passphrase below.

vault phrase of bagap-bahaf = silion-pelox-sorox-casdor-quenwyn-fraax-eliox-praael-kelion-quenvan-kasox-rusael-norius-belvan